Basic Information

Product Name 4-Isopropyl-6-Nitroquinolin-2(1H)-One
CAS No. 934687-46-4
Molecular Formula C₁₂H₁₂N₂O₃
Molecular Weight 232.24 g/mol
Synonyms 6-Nitro-4-(propan-2-yl)quinolin-2(1H)-one; 4-(1-Methylethyl)-6-nitro-2(1H)-quinolinone; 4-Isopropyl-6-nitro-1,2-dihydroquinolin-2-one; 4-Isopropyl-6-nitro-2-hydroxyquinoline; 4-Isopropyl-6-nitroquinolin-2-ol; 6-Nitro-4-isopropyl-2-quinolinol; 934687-46-4

Specification

Item Specification
Appearance Yellow to light brown powder
Identification (IR) Conforms to structure
Purity (HPLC) ≥ 97.0%
Loss on Drying ≤ 0.5%
Residue on Ignition ≤ 0.1%
Heavy Metals ≤ 20 ppm
